hi, ive got a mk1 1.2 clio with ph2 16v speedline wheels 195/50/15 an i wanted to lower it but the back wheels look like there going to rub if i do.
anyone know if thay will ?
 
  Rb 182
Mines is down 60-70mm on ph 1 172 wheels and it needs spacers on the rear. 3mm only though, if you go really low the wheels rub off the top shock bolt.

Mines is a 1.4Rt
